Andrea Belotti's future has been causing much discussions in recent days. The centre-forward, in fact, is at the center of the discussions for his expiring contract in 2022. At the moment, he does not seem to want to renew. The attacker asks for technical guarantees to renew.
The scenario proposed today by Tuttosport sees Urbano Cairo, President of Torino, at the crossroads in the management of the player. To keep him, he would have to materialize a long series of works, from reinforcing the club and structures to an important market to strengthen the squad, and renewing the club's ambitions.
The newspaper defines the Rossoneri as one of the interested clubs and talks about the management actually pressing for the player already. In short, Maldini certainly monitors Belotti's situation very carefully and works on the possible transfer for the summer. The Rossoneri could also include Krunic in the negotiation, a profile that could interest Torino for their midfield. In this way, they could lower the cash part required by the operation.
